MySQL是一种常用的关系型数据库管理系统,提供了备份和恢复数据库的功能,以确保数据的安全性和可靠性。在本文中,我们将详细介绍MySQL备份与恢复的过程,并介绍tee命令的使用,它可以同时将输出内容显示在屏幕上并保存到文件中。
备份MySQL数据库
要备份MySQL数据库,可以使用mysqldump命令。该命令可以将数据库的结构和数据导出为SQL语句的形式,以便稍后恢复。以下是备份MySQL数据库的示例命令:
mysqldump -u 用户名 -p 密码 数据库名 > 备份文件名.sql
其中,用户名是连接MySQL数据库的用户名,密码是对应的密码,数据库名是要备份的数据库的名称,备份文件名.sql是将备份保存为的文件名。
例如,如果要备份名为mydatabase的数据库,并将备份保存为backup.sql文件,可以使用以下命令:
mysqldump -u root -p mydatabase > backup.sql
在执行命令后,系统会提示输入密码。输入正确密码后,备份过程将开始,并将生成的SQL语句保存到backup.sql文件中。
恢复MySQL数据库
要恢复MySQL数据库,可以使用mysql命令。该命令可以执行SQL语句,将导出的备份文件中的数据和结构导入到数据库中。以下是恢复MySQL数据库的示例命令:
mysql -u
本文概述了MySQL数据库的备份和恢复过程,利用mysqldump进行数据库备份,通过mysql进行恢复。同时,介绍了tee命令的使用,该命令能同时显示输出并保存到文件,便于记录和分析MySQL操作。
订阅专栏 解锁全文

1191

被折叠的 条评论
为什么被折叠?



